If your drinking water comes from an exclusive well, you are accountable for your water's safety and security. If you have never had your water evaluated, it is constantly an excellent suggestion to enlighten yourself on what exists in your drinking water and additionally give yourself with some standard details in the occasion there are adjustments in the future that may affect the quality of your supply of water.

You can expect to receive your results in the mail 2-4 weeks after your examples have been obtained at the NCWQR lab (Well Water Testing). The NCWQR collaborates with regional sponsoring organizations to offer well water screening solutions to individuals in their area, area, or group


The NCWQR gives the region workplace or company with water testing kits to disperse over a one-two week period. The office functions as a collection website for the packages offered and also manages the delivery of sets to the laboratory. The individual gets their private cause 2-4 weeks. The complying company receives a summary quickly after.

If a map is preferred, the company needs to supply a county guidebook with participants' areas marked. This map requires to be sent to the NCWQR with the kits at the close of the program. This program was started by the National Center for Water High Quality Study in 1987 for the testing of personal well water in Ohio.


Currently, the program is supplied across the country and, to date, over 35,000 wells have actually been evaluated from 25 various other states. If you wish to recognize whether chemical contaminants are in your well water, we can check your well water for inorganic compounds like nitrate and see it here metals, in addition to chemicals as well as various other natural compounds like gas and solvents.

For the most part, the presence of WQIs is not the reason for health issues; nonetheless, they are easy to examine for and their visibility might suggest the presence of sewage and other disease-causing germs from human and/or animal feces. (Please see Water-related Diseases and also Pollutants secretive Wells for a list of added germs as well as chemicals in drinking water wells and the illnesses they create.) Overall Coliforms, Coliform microorganisms are microbes found in the digestive systems of warm-blooded pets, in soil, on plants, as well as in surface water.
